What Is A Foundation?

     Foundation:  spiritually is the basis of sound doctrine and experiences of The Kingdom of God.  The term “foundation” comes from the language of building and architecture.  A solid and stable foundation is necessary to support the superstructure of any building.  The taller the building, the deeper the foundation must be.

     Please, familiarize yourself with the scripture text above.  You are therefore, responsible and accountable for the memorization and the understanding of these scriptures throughout this teaching.

And are built upon the foundation of the Apostles and Prophets, Jesus Christ Himself being the chief corner stone;

In whom all the building fitly framed together growth unto an holy temple in the Lord:

In whom ye also are builded together for an habitation of God through the Spirit.

Ephesians 2:20-22

 

     According to the writer of the Book of Hebrews he put it into terms of first principles.  We must have these experiences before maturing in Christ.  We cannot have a building permit to erect the edifice until the Holy Spirit, God’s building inspector, finds our foundation ready.  The following are transforming encounters with the risen Christ: 

 

  • Repentance from Dead Works
  • Faith toward God
  • Doctrine of Baptisms
  • Laying on of Hands
  • Resurrection of the Dead
  • Eternal Judgment

     From Hebrews 6:1-3, we will examine and study the foundational stones of the Christian life and the foundational principles of The Kingdom of God.

     Masons or the Masonic Lodge disallowed, rejected and set aside the corner stone, because it was different from all other stones.  It did not fit into any of the unusual places. 

     Israel also rejected her own Messiah, because He didn’t fit into their expectations.  The first truth in terms of life-transforming experiences and the first foundational kingdom principle or “foundation stones” will not fit our mindset of religion and traditions of men.  As we begin to build with these foundational stones, we must be prepared to start all over form the beginning with the very first one, which is called, “Repentance form Dead Works”.  This is repudiation of tradition and unworkable theories.

     Notice that the writer in the Book of Hebrews is telling us to leave the principles of the doctrine of Christ.  He is literally telling us to go on from the beginning.  We are not to stop and constantly review the first elementary truths we learned in Christ.  It is possible to leave them not in the sense of forsaking them but in the sense of using them as a firm grounding underneath us while we reach on to higher truths.  This can be done sense these first truths form a foundation and establish us in such a way that these truths will no longer slip away from us.  As always, we trust in the Lord, Jesus Christ and continue to seek first, The Kingdom of God in all areas.

     Themelios (the-me-li-os) is the greek word for “Foundation”.  The verb form not only means laying the foundation, but to ground someone, to establish them, or to render firm and unwavering.  We should have such a real experience with God; a demonstration of The Kingdom of God in both power and understanding, through the obedience of His word through these foundational truths that are set on a firm footing for the remainder of our Kingdom life and Christian walk.
